If I remember correctly... use boost::ref() on the variables in your call to function_call: function_call(boost::ref(myVar)); Date: Mon, 2 Mar 2009 01:09:27 -0800 From: [email protected] To: [email protected] Subject: [luabind] return_stl_iterator acting as const? Greetings all, I'm having a problem setting the value of a class contained within a std::vector from lua, I have the following code: C++: class ContainedObject { public: int value; }; class ContainerObject { public: std::vector<ContainedObject> vec; int containervalue; }; luabind::module(L) [ luabind::class<ContainedObject>("ContainedObject") .def(luabind::constructor<>()) .def_readwrite("value", &ContainedObject::value), luabind::class_<ContainerObject>("ContainerObject") .def_readwrite("containervalue", &ContainerObject::containervalue) .def_readwrite("vec", &ContainerObject::vec, luabind::return_stl_iterator) ]; ContainerObject cont; ContainedObject Obj; Obj.value = 10; cont.push_back(Obj); cont.containervalue = 15; luabind::call_function<void>(L, "LuaFunction", &cont); std::cout << cont.containervalue << std::endl; std::cout << cont.vec[0].value << std::endl; Lua code: function LuaFunction( cont ) print (cont.containervalue) cont.containervalue = 30 for things in cont.vec do print (things.value) things.vlaue = 5 end end Which prints out: 15 10 30 10 So I am able to modify the containervalue of ContainerObject, but I am not able to modify the ContainedObject value. Any thoughts here? Is luabind making a copy of the vector as it passes it off?
